默认冷灰
24号文字
方正启体

第542章 宇宙产品需求文档第一条,把“死亡”这个BUG给我删了

    整个创世工作室,安静得像是一座巨大的服务器坟场。

    上百万个键盘侠,哦不,是创世神们,此刻全都保持着一个石化的姿势,呆呆地看着那个坐在项目总监老板椅上、正在悠闲转圈的古代帝王。

    刚才,这个男人用最平淡的语气,发布了一个足以让整个宇宙系统内核崩溃(kernel panic)的更新需求。

    ——十二个时辰内,拿出覆盖全宇宙的【系统重构方案】。

    那个穿着polo衫的项目经理(pm)和地中海发型的技术总监(cto)互相看了一眼,都在对方的黑眼圈里看到了四个字:

    【这需求,有毒。】

    赢正转椅子的动作停了下来。

    他睁开眼。

    那目光,比项目上线前夜的bug报告还要冰冷。

    “十二个时辰。”

    “是从刚才朕说完话的时候开始算的。”

    赢正指了指挂在墙上的一个由无数星辰组成的原子钟。

    “现在,已经过去了一炷香的时间。”

    “怎么?”

    “你们是觉得这份工作太清闲了,还是觉得朕的剑……不够快?”

    白起很配合地用一块丝绸擦拭了一下他那把刚刚斩断了cto求生欲的剑,那动作优雅得像是在切一块完美的提拉米苏。

    “不不不!总监!哦不,陛下总监!”

    那pm连滚带爬地跑了过来,手里拿着一块备用的全息白板和一支笔。

    “我们立刻开工!马上开工!”

    他一脸谄媚地笑道:“那个……为了确保我们的开发方向符合您的宏伟蓝图,您能不能……稍微提一下具体的需求细则?”

    这是项目管理的第一步,需求沟通。

    虽然,这次的需求方看起来像是能随时把整个开发团队都给物理删除的狠角色。

    “哦?”

    赢正来了兴致。

    “也罢。”

    “朕就给你们这些凡人工匠,开一次【宇宙V1.0·大秦版】的产品需求评审会。”

    赢正伸出第一根手指。

    用一种不容置疑的、仿佛在陈述“太阳东升西落”一般天经地义的语气,说出了他的第一个需求。

    “第一条。”

    “把‘死亡’这个设定。”

    “给朕,删了。”

    “……”

    “……啥?”

    那pm手里的笔“啪嗒”一声掉在了地上。

    a

    他怀疑自己的音频接收模块出了故障。

    不光是他,全场上百万个程序员,在听到这句话的瞬间,集体感觉自己的代码树像是被一只无形的大脚狠狠踩了上去,每一行都发出了哀嚎。

    “陛……陛下……”

    那cto鼓起了此生最大的勇气,颤颤巍巍地开口。

    “这个……这个需求……可能……有那么一点点……”

    “实现难度。”

    “哦?”赢正饶有兴致地看着他,“难在何处?”

    “陛下,您听我解释!”

    cto感觉自己的大脑正在以史无前例的速度运转,试图把复杂的系统架构翻译成这位古代暴君能听懂的大白话。

    “‘死亡’模块,它……它不是一个功能,它是我们这个宇宙操作系统的……底层驱动啊!”

    他调出一张巨大的系统架构图,指着那个位于最核心、连接着所有模块的红色方块。

    “您看,‘出生’与‘死亡’,构成了整个系统的【资源回收机制】。灵魂的产出与回收,能量的守恒,文明的迭代……全靠它来维持动态平衡!”

    “要是没了死亡,新生的灵魂不断产生,旧的灵魂又不消失,那服务器……啊不,是宇宙,会被挤爆的!会发生严重的内存泄漏,最后导致整个系统彻底崩溃啊!”

    cto越说越激动,甚至带上了哭腔。

    “而且,这个模块和其他所有模块都是耦合的!‘情感’、‘恐惧’、‘勇气’、‘传承’……这些高级功能都是基于‘生命有限’这个前提建立的!”

    “您这等于说,要把我们这栋摩天大楼的地基给抽了,去盖个平房啊!牵一发动全身啊陛下!”

    他说完, nervously地看着赢正。

    希望这位“产品总监”能理解其中的技术壁垒,然后知难而退。

    然而。

    赢正听完这番声情并茂的陈述,脸上的表情没有丝毫变化。

    他只是淡淡地问了一句:

    “说完了?”

    cto下意识地点头。

    “说完了,就给朕滚去改。”

    赢正站了起来,一脚踢翻了旁边堆积如山的泡面桶。

    “朕不管你们什么‘地基’,什么‘平衡’。”

    “朕只知道。”

    赢正指着自己。

    “朕,不想死。”

    他又指了指虚空。

    “朕的子民,也不该死。”

    a

    “至于你说的什么‘服务器会爆炸’……”

    赢正冷笑一声。

    “那是你们这些工匠无能。”

    “服务器不够,就给朕加。”

    “内存不够,就给朕扩。”

    “技术实现不了?”

    赢正指着那个快哭出来的cto。

    “那就换个能实现的来。”

    他走到白起身边,用那把带着血腥味的剑,拍了拍cto的脸。

    “朕听说,你们这个职业,有一种说法,叫做‘祭天’。”

    “如果一个功能实在做不出来,就把负责的程序员祭天,bug自然就消失了。”

    “朕觉得。”

    “这个方法……很好。”

    cto双腿一软,直接跪了下去,冷汗把他的“I ? codE”文化衫都浸透了。

    完了。

    这是个完全不讲道理、只讲结果的魔鬼甲方。

    就在气氛僵到冰点的时候。

    李斯咳嗽了一声,拿着一本小册子走了上来。

    “陛下息怒。”

    李斯先是对赢正行了一礼,然后才转向那群快要吓出宕机画面的程序员。

    “这些技术人员的意思,微臣大概明白了。”

    a

    李斯的语气,瞬间从一个臣子,切换成了一个高级产品经理。

    “他们是说,直接删除``这个核心文件,会导致系统不稳定。”

    “但我们并不一定需要删除文件。”

    李斯露出了他那标志性的、能把稻草说成黄金的微笑。

    “陛下想要的,是‘永生’的结果,而不是‘删除死亡’的过程,对吗?”

    赢正没说话,算是默许。

    “那么,我们可以换个思路。”

    李斯在白板上画了一个图。

    “我们可以创建一个……【用户权限管理系统】。”

    “所有大乾的子民,其账户默认划归到‘管理员(Admin)’用户组,这个组的用户,对于‘死亡模块’拥有‘只读’权限。”

    “也就是说,他们能看见死亡,但死亡无法对他们执行。”

    李斯又画了一个圈。

    “而我们的敌人,则划归到‘访客(Guest)’用户组。这个组的用户,不仅要面临死亡,我们还可以随时右键,选择‘强制清空回收站’,让他们连投胎的机会都没有。”

    他这一番话,说得那帮程序员一愣一愣的。

    这……这不就是搞特权、搞歧视吗?

    但是……

    听起来……好像……在技术上……是可行的?!

    那个cto眼睛一亮,像是抓到了救命稻草:“对对对!权限管理!我们可以写一个权限判断的if语句! `if( == daqian) { ; }` ……可以!这个可以!”

    “早这么说不就行了?”

    赢正不耐烦地摆了摆手。

    t

    “朕没空听你们解释那些乱七八糟的后台代码,朕只要结果。”

    他坐回椅子上,伸出第二根手指。

    “第二条。”

    “重构宇宙UI(用户界面)。”

    “这黑漆漆的背景,太单调了。给朕换成纯黑底色,上面用烫金代码写满我大乾的律法。天空背景图,用九条金龙戏珠的动态壁纸,要24K纯金特效,不许卡顿。”

    “还有,所有的恒星(太阳),都太亮了,晃眼,还俗气。全部给朕改成亮度较低的、巨大的、燃烧的黑色龙纹玉玺形态。”

    “噗——”

    一个负责天文物理引擎的程序员当场喷出一口咖啡。

    把恒星改成玉玺?那引力模型和光合作用怎么办?!生态圈会全部崩溃的!

    赢正没理他,伸出第三根手指。

    “第三条。”

    “统一全宇宙的度量衡和通讯协议。”

    “以后所有文明,时间用‘咸阳时’,距离用‘秦里’,货币用‘秦半两’。”

    “语言全部强制安装‘小篆’语言包,不兼容的,让他们自己想办法格式化重装。”

    负责文明多样性模块的小组,集体晕了过去。

    赢正喝了口茶,继续说道。

    “第四条,重构星际交通网络。什么虫洞、星门,全部改成‘轨道交通’,最终站点必须且只能是咸阳宫。朕要打造一个‘宇宙半时辰生活圈’。”

    ……

    赢正一口气提了十几条堪称丧心病狂的需求。

    -

    每一条,都让一个部门的程序员感受到了来自灵魂深处的绝望。

    等他说完。

    整个办公室已经哀鸿遍野。

    “好了。”

    赢正站起身。

    “具体的需求,李斯会整理成一份《宇宙重构需求文档V1.0》,发到你们每个人手上。”

    他走到那个已经面如死灰的cto面前。

    “现在,朕来重新任命一下项目组的核心成员。”

    “李斯,担任新世界的总架构师兼项目总监。”

    “白起,担任首席质量官(cqo),负责代码审查和bug测试。”

    赢正指着白起,“他的测试方法很简单,谁的代码出了bug,他就把谁变成bug。”

    白起冷漠地点了点头,让在场所有人的脖子都凉飕飕的。

    “李元霸,担任运维总管,负责物理硬件维护。哪个服务器卡了,让他去敲一敲,保证流畅。”

    最后,赢正看着这个cto。

    “至于你。”

    “你就是开发组的组长了。”

    “十二个时辰后。”

    “我要看到一个可以运行的alpha版。”

    “如果看不到……”

    赢正没再说话,只是指了指办公室中央那块巨大的空地。

    那里,刚好可以搭一个祭坛。

    cto欲哭无泪。

    他这哪是升职了?这是被架在火上烤啊!

    赢正交代完,便带着人走到办公室最顶层的一个豪华套间里休息去了,把这个烂摊子留给了这群热锅上的程序员。

    “动起来!!都给我动起来!!”

    李斯拿着赢正的佩剑当令箭,像个监工一样吼道。

    “美工组!赶紧出龙纹壁纸的高保真贴图!”

    “网络组!给我重新规划全宇宙的路由表!”

    “底层架构组!那个永生补丁赶紧给我打上!!”

    整个创世工作室,第一次爆发出了超越996的、堪称007的奋斗热情。

    因为这次,完不成KpI,是真的会死。

    就在所有人都陷入疯狂的编码工作时。

    那个新上任的开发组长cto,一个人躲在角落,手指在键盘上飞速敲击着,但他打开的不是开发环境,而是一个隐藏极深的后台命令行。

    他的眼神中,闪烁着不甘与疯狂。

    “疯子……这群人都是疯子……”

    他喃喃自语。

    “想把这个世界变成他的私有服务器?没门!”

    他输入了一行又一行神秘的代码,试图绕过赢正的监控。

    “系统……系统一定有更高权限的存在……”

    “一定有那个最终的、创造了我们所有人的……【创始人】……”

    他按下回车。

    `./tact_the_ --level=urgent`

    一行信息被发送了出去。

    三秒后。

    t

    他的屏幕上,弹回了一个回复。

    很简单,只有一个单词。

    `[Aowledged.]`

    `(已阅)`

    紧接着,另一行信息浮现出来,让cto瞬间瞪大了眼睛。

    `[A new user has logged into the system root directory.]`

    `(一个新用户已登录系统根目录)`

    `(Id: pangu_01)`